The Syrian Global Diaspora: Migrants from Syria, Lebanon, Palestine and Jordan since the 1880s Audio Quality: please note the audio quality of this particular podcast is not optimal The Professor of the Economic History of Asia and Africa has made many fundamental contributions on the history of commodities and labour, including Islam and the Abolition of Slavery and Cocoa and Chocolate. William Clarence-Smith 14 March 2011
